java中web.xml对Servlet进行配置

<?xml version="1.0" encoding="UTF-8"?>

<web-app 
  
  xmlns="http://xmlns.jcp.org/xml/ns/javaee"
  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ee
                      http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d"
  version="4.0"
  metadata-complete="true">
           
           <!-- 
             servlet配置 : 前端是通过网址来访问服务器
                           需要给servlet对象配置一个外部访问的路径
           -->

           <!-- 1.配置servlet -->
           <servlet>
           
                 <!-- 给servlet起一个对象名 -->
                 <servlet-name>firstServlet</servlet-name>
                 
                 <!-- 实例化该servlet的类名 -->
                 <servlet-class>com.xalo.myservlet.myServlet</servlet-class>
           </servlet>
           
           <!-- 
              2. 给上面的servlet配置URL 
                给servlet映射一个url路径
           -->
           <servlet-mapping>
                 <!-- 要配置路径的servlet -->
                 <servlet-name>firstServlet</servlet-name>
                 
                 <!-- url 相对路径 
                    主机地址/工程名/pattern里面的路径
                 -->
                 
                 <!-- 精确路径配置 -->
                 <!-- <url-pattern>/login</url-pattern> -->
                 
                 <!-- 精确后缀名,路径名统配 
                 	只能写成*.后缀名
                 	不能和精确路径结合使用    例如/user/*.后缀名 错误 -->
                <!-- <url-pattern>*.do</url-pattern> -->
                
                <!-- 路径部分统配 -->
                <url-pattern>/user/*</url-pattern>
                <!-- 一个servlet可以映射多个url -->
                <!-- <url-pattern>*.html</url-pattern> -->
           </servlet-mapping>
                <!--  3.欢迎页配置。启动服务器之后自定义加载的界面
  		       如果配置了多个欢迎页,他会自上而下的找,找到存在的就直接展示
  		-->
  		<welcome-file-list>
  			<welcome-file>/register.html</welcome-file>
  			<welcome-file>/index.html</welcome-file>
                  </welcome-file-list>
</web-app>

猜你喜欢

转载自blog.csdn.net/qq_42401622/article/details/80658080